South Alabama vs Auburn Preview

South Alabama Jaguars Betting Preview: [Editorial Language]
South Alabama is coming into this game 1-1, with a win over FCS Morgan State and a loss against Tulane. Despite being down by 16 with six minutes to play, the Jaguars managed to come storming back before missing the game-tying two-point conversion and failing to convert the onside kick.
However, the Jaguars' defense was the reason they got put in the hole in the first place. From an efficiency perspective, they are damn near disastrous so far. They rank 99th nationally in Opponent Average Field position, 105th in Success Rate allowed and 123rd in Opponent's Finishing Drives. And that was against an FCS team and a Group of Four Tulane squad.
In particular, they struggled against the run, ranking 101st in Rushing PPA Allowed and 105th in Rushing Success Rate Allowed. Tulane noticed and did not let up, with three players rushing for 60 or more yards. Assuming Auburn has working eyes, they will have picked up on this with the tape. Expect some good old-fashioned SEC ground and pound out of the Tigers.
The Jaguars' offense is a bit tougher to measure. The first game was against an FCS opponent, and it didn't come alive until the last ten minutes of the game against Tulane. The question is, will we get the Jaguars team that scored 14 points in six minutes? Or will we get the team that was down 33-17 in the third quarter?
Unfortunately, I think it may be the latter. Despite the late-game success, Jaguars QB Bishop Davenport has struggled, posting only a 54.5 PFF grade and a Turnover Worthy Play rate of 8.9% compared to a Big Time Throw Rate of 2.4%. I don't expect him to improve against Auburn. See below for South Alabama's key metrics:

Auburn Tigers Betting Preview: [Editorial Language]
The Tigers are coming into this game fresh off a 2-0 start that saw them torch Ball State and beat a good Baylor team in week 1. In a year where the SEC looks wide open, the Tigers could make some noise. We currently have the Tigers in the top ten of our power ranking, but the market has not caught up. The Tigers are +2500 (10th-best odds) to win the SEC and +5000 to win the National Championship (18th-best odds) if you are interested in that kind of thing.
The Tigers have been led by an offense that is less efficient and more grinding. The Tigers rank 12th in success rate and 19th in points per opportunity, but 117th in explosiveness. Unsurprisingly, this offense is powered by the run game, where the Tigers have had a lot of volume and success. They rank 20th in Rushing Plays Rate, 25th in Rushing PPA and 21st in Rushing Success Rate. Remember when I said South Alabama can't defend the run well? I don't think it will get better.
So far, Jeremiah Cobb and Quarterback Jackson Arnold have had nearly identical rushing yardages, with Cobb at 195 and Arnold at 182. While the Tigers CAN throw the ball (9th in Passing Success Rate), they've shown that if they don't have to throw the ball, they will not. With the brunt of an SEC schedule coming up, I don't see the Tigers going deep in their offensive playbook to beat the Jags.
